The message or meaning of a play is _____. theme monologue exposition incident

Answers

Answer: A) Theme.

Explanation: In literature, the theme is the underlying message of a story (written, spoken, or acted), it is  what critical belief about life is the author trying to convey in the writing of a novel, play, short story or poem. Usually this belief, or idea, is universal and transcends cultural barriers. So, from the given options the one that represents the given definition, is the corresponding to option A: theme.

Explanation:

The sentence that has a misplaced modifier is A. A misplaced modifier is a word, phrase, or clause that is separated from the word it modifies or describes. Because of this separation, sentences with this mistake often sound awkward.

In A, the misplaced modifier is the participle phrase "wearing shorts and sneakers".  The position of said modifier makes the sentence sound as if the one wearing shorts and sneakers was the dog. The modifier should be placed next to the noun it is supposed to modify. Therefore, a possible version of the sentence would be the following: Wearing shorts and sneakers, I walked my dog this morning.
